WORK ISSUE HALTS DETROIT'S PAPERS; Publishers Charge Strike and the Union a Lockout in Mailers Dispute
Date: 19 August 1957
Special to The New York Times
3 Detroit papers suspend; Detroit Publishers Assn charges strike is illegal; union charges lockout; News claims only 1 man was discharged; Teamsters local refuses to deliver papers; ITU pres Randolph queries move, wire to Teamsters exec Hoffa; says strike is inspired by ex-ITU members, s, NYC; Massachusetts Comr Johnson urges ITU repudiate mailers rejection of Boston papers offer; publisher Choate comments on offer

STRIKE HALTS RUN OF DETROIT NEWS; Dissident Mailers Say They Are Locked Out--Refused to Work Overtime
Date: 18 August 1957
Special to The New York Times
Internatl Mailers Union (Ind) strikes Detroit News for discharging 87 mailers who refused overtime work; 6 were ITU mailers; ITU mailers hon pact; scuffle with pickets; News suspends; Detroit Free Press and Times carry News masthead at News request; ITU mailers reject 'final' offer of Boston papers
